XML Schema notation ইলেকট্রন
সংজ্ঞা ও ব্যবহার
notation ইলেকট্রন XML ডকুমেন্টের মধ্যে অসম্পর্কিত ডাটা ফরম্যাটকে বর্ণনা করে
ইলেকট্রন তথ্য
উপস্থিতির সংখ্যা | অসীমিত |
মাত্রা | schema |
বিষয় | annotation |
বিন্যাস
<notation id=ID name=NCName public=anyURI system=anyURI কোনও অ্যাট্রিবিউট > (annotation?) </notation>
(? ট্যাগ নোটেশন ইলেকট্রনের মধ্যে উপস্থিত হতে পারে কোনও সময় বা একবারের জন্য。)
অ্যাট্রিবিউট | বর্ণনা |
---|---|
id | বাধ্যতামূলক নয়। এই ইলেকট্রনের অভিনব ID নির্দিষ্ট করুন |
name | বাধ্যতামূলক। এই ইলেকট্রনের নাম নির্দিষ্ট করুন |
public | বাধ্যতামূলক। public ট্যাগের সাথে সংযুক্ত যোগাযোগ URI |
system | system ট্যাগের সাথে সংযুক্ত যোগাযোগ URI |
কোনও অ্যাট্রিবিউট | বাধ্যতামূলক নয়। non-schema নামক স্পেসসমূহকে যে কোনও অন্য অ্যাট্রিবিউট নির্দিষ্ট করুন |
একটি উদাহরণ
উদাহরণ 1
এই উদাহরণটি view.exe নামক একটি দেখার অ্যাপলিকেশন ব্যবহার করে �gif এবং jpeg ফরম্যাটের notation দেখানোর জন্য প্রদর্শিত হয়:
<?xml version="1.0"?> <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ema"> <xs:notation name="gif" public="image/gif" system="view.exe"/> <xs:notation name="jpeg" public="image/jpeg" system="view.exe"/> <xs:element name="image"> <xs:complexType> <xs:simpleContent> <xs:attribute name="type"> <xs:simpleType> <xs:restriction base="xs:NOTATION"> <xs:enumeration value="gif"/> <xs:enumeration value="jpeg"/> <xs:restriction> </xs:simpleType> </xs:attribute> </xs:simpleContent> </xs:complexType> </xs:element> </xs:schema>
องค์ประกอบ "image" ในเอกสารนี้เป็นอย่างนี้:
<image type="gif"></image>